Research Article: Classification of Subtypes of Vernal Keratoconjunctivitis by Cluster Analysis Based on Clinical Features
Abstract:
Vernal keratoconjunctivitis (VKC) is a chronic ocular inflammatory disorder which is most prevalent among males, with onset typically occurring before age and resolving at puberty. VKC is characterized by severe inflammation affecting both the cornea and conjunctiva, such as hyperemia, chemosis, photophobia, mucous discharge, giant papillae of the upper tarsal conjunctiva, limbal Horner-Trantas dots, superficial keratopathy and corneal shield ulcers., Although the symptoms of VKC usually persist despite treatment, it generally subsides with the onset of puberty, but some therapeutic measures may be required beyond this age to control the course of the disease, especially in those cases associated with atopic dermatitis (AD), in whom permanent changes to the ocular surface may occur, accompanied by permanent visual impairment. Although cases have been treated with medical management and environmental control, varying responses to similar medication have been observed in VKC, and the reasons underlying the variation in clinical outcomes among VKC cases have been poorly studied and little understood. Therefore, there is a need to develop a novel classification of subtypes of VKC. The prognosis may differ according to the disease phenotype of VKC; however, to our knowledge, no attempt has been made to classify patients into subgroups based on VKC features and demographic characteristics.
